Windows Server SSL证书安装与配置入门
Windows Server 通过SSL证书进行加密通信是网络安全的重要环节。本文将详细讲解如何在Windows Server上安装和配置SSL证书。我们需要选择合适的证书颁发机构(CA),然后使用 OpenSSL工具生成自签名或受信任的证书。我们将证书导入到IIS服务器中,并配置HTTPS设置以启用安全通信。我们还将讨论如何管理证书的有效期、更新和备份,以确保系统的安全性。
Windows Server SSL证书的安装与配置
准备工作
确定所需的SSL证书类型:
- 自签名证书:适用于开发环境或测试环境。
- CA颁发证书:适用于生产环境,通过受信任的CA机构签发。
获取SSL证书:
- Certifi中:免费提供各种类型的证书。
- Let's Encrypt:一个开源、免费且自动化的服务,提供HTTPS证书。
- DigiCert:商业级别的SSL证书供应商。
安装SSL证书到IIS
配置IIS:
1. 打开Internet Information Services (IIS)管理器。
2. 在“控制面板” -> “程序” -> “程序功能”。
3. 勾选“Internet信息 Services”并点击“确定”。
创建一个新的网站:
1. 在IIS管理器中,右键点击“站点”,选择“添加网站”。
2. 输入网站名称、物理路径、端口等信息,然后点击“确定”。
配置SSL绑定:
1. 右键点击新的网站,选择“属性”。
2. 在“网站”选项卡中,点击“绑定”。
3. 点击“新建”,输入SSL协议和证书文件路径。
4. 确认绑定设置后,点击“确定”。
配置SSL证书到Web应用
将SSL证书附加到Web应用:
1. 在IIS管理器中,右键点击Web应用,选择“属性”。
2. 在“常规”选项卡中,找到“SSL证书”部分。
3. 选择你之前创建的SSL证书,然后点击“确定”。
验证SSL证书配置
使用浏览器验证:
1. 打开浏览器,访问你的网站。
2. 检查浏览器地址栏,是否显示了绿色的锁图标,并且域名后面有“s”表示该网站启用了SSL。
使用命令行工具验证:
1. 打开命令提示符,导航到你的网站目录。
2. 运行以下命令来检查SSL证书的有效性和状态:
certutil -dump -store my "your_certificate_name"
注意事项
备份重要数据:在进行任何SSL证书操作之前,请确保备份重要的数据。
更新证书:定期更新SSL证书以保持安全性。
监控日志:启用详细的日志记录,以便在出现问题时快速定位问题。
通过以上步骤,你应该能够在Windows Server上成功安装和配置SSL证书,为你的网站提供更安全的网络连接。
扫描二维码推送至手机访问。
声明:本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。